I’m building a small backup utility that periodically retrieves all my Lunch Money transactions and saves them to a Google Sheet. While implementing this, I noticed that although the API provides filtering based on a transaction’s creation date, there’s currently no way to query transactions that have been updated after a given timestamp. For applications that sync Lunch Money data into their own database, the ability to request only transactions updated since the last sync would be extremely valuable. A last_updated_after filter would: Prevent repeatedly fetching the entire transaction set Reduce load on Lunch Money’s servers Improve performance for developers maintaining external sync systems Adding this filter would make incremental sync workflows far more efficient and developer-friendly.
